## Summary
Brzozów is a city located in Poland, within the continent of Europe. It serves as the administrative seat for both Gmina Brzozów and Brzozów County. Founded in 1359, the city has a population of 7,366 people as of the 2021 census.

### Geography and Demographics
The city covers an area of **11.45 square kilometres** and is geographically positioned at coordinates 49.695°N, 22.019°E. Demographic data from the **Polish census of 2021** records a total population of **7,366**. This is split between a **male population** of 3,524 and a **female population** of 3,842. Historical population data shows fluctuations over time:
- 2001: 7,739
- 2004: 7,799
- 2009: 7,836
- 2014: 7,550
- 2017: 7,516
- 2020: 7,289
